Tomato Pie

Tomato_pie_2

I hope we all enjoyed meat loaf week.  This week, I'm going to post a few recipes that I'm going to make for Thanksgiving, or would be Thanksgiving-appropriate.

I'm going to make this one on Thursday.  It's intriguing to me, and I can't quite fathom what it might taste like.  Does it taste like tomatoes, or is it more of a cheesey-bready au gratiny flavor?  I suppose it's really a crustless quiche, isn't it?  If I remember in the flurry of cooking, I'll take a picture and post it.

Cabbage Slaw

Nelda_wagstaff_cabbage_slaw_2

This is my favorite card. I love the vivacious housewife with the 16-inch waist, jaunty chef's hat, and can-do attitude that says, "Voila! It was so easy!"

I'm intrigued by the "PetRecipe" line on the card. Isn't there a Pet brand of foods?  Or does Pet Recipe mean a favorite recipe?  Or could it mean...Oh God! Fluffy! Nooooooo!

Relievedly, no animals appear to have been harmed in the making of this cabbage slaw.
